50 positions at 0.40 mm pitch – board-stacking selection
The DF40TC(4.0)-50DS-0.4V(51): The 0.40 mm pitch packs 50 circuits into a narrow footprint, which demands careful trace escape and via fan-out on the PCB – a 4-layer board is typical for routing the inner rows.
4 mm stack height – what it buys the layout
The height above board is 3.90 mm, meaning the receptacle body stands just under the 4 mm stack target. The 0.40 mm pitch drives the board footprint – the contact pads are spaced tightly, so the PCB layout must match the Hirose recommended land pattern to avoid solder bridging during reflow.
